Segment - General Skating News
- British Ice Skating is sad to announce the passing of skating legend Bernard Ford on April 5, 2023.
- Skate Guard 2013 article with Diana Towler Green and Bernard Ford:: https://skateguard1.blogspot.com/2013/07/diane-towler-green-and-bernard-ford.html
- Midori Ito is registered to compete once again in the International Adult Competition in Oberstdorf, Germany.
- Dallas Classic has been added as the first NQS competition for ice dance.
- U.S. Figure Skating announced its 2024 Synchronized Skating qualifying season.
- USFS’ International Selection Pool has been updated since Nationals.

Segment - Social Media Updates
- Georgia's Karina Safina announced the end of partnership with Luka Berulava.
- Georgia's Luka Berulava also posted his own message.
- Isabelle Martins and Ryan Bedard have repartnered and she will relocate to Irvine, CA from Chicago at the end of the school year. Rohene Ward has choreographed their SP.
- Israel’s Shira Ichilov / Dmitriy Kravchenko are announced as a new ice dance team.
- USA’s Anastasiia Smirnova/Danil Siianytsia announced their program music for 2023-24
- Solene Mazingue and Marko Gaidajenko have launched a GoFundMe to help with her ongoing therapy and their training expenses.
- Mariia Holubtsova and Kyryl Bielobrov of Ukraine have started a Patreon to help with their training expenses.
